Specified for Cornwall properties

Standard specification
  • End-grain sealed at every cut before assembly — the single detail that decides whether joinery rots.
  • Compression seals rather than brush pile where the design allows, for a measurably tighter close.
  • Micro-porous finishes that let the timber breathe rather than trapping moisture behind a hard film.
  • FSC-certified hardwood with documented chain of custody, available on request for planning submissions.
  • Factory-finished in controlled conditions — three coats minimum, fully cured before delivery.

What is Accoya and is it worth the premium?

Accoya is timber that has been acetylated — chemically modified so it no longer absorbs water. It barely moves, does not rot, and carries a 50-year above-ground warranty. It is the single best paint substrate available. For exposed elevations and coastal sites the premium usually pays for itself.

Will the timber warp or stick?

Not if it is specified correctly. Sticking comes from moisture ingress into unsealed end grain, or from solid stock used where laminated sections were needed. Kiln-dried timber, sealed end grain, factory finishing and engineered sections on longer spans between them eliminate it.

Can you fit trickle vents?

Where Building Regulations require background ventilation, we design it into the head of the frame at manufacture. That looks far better and performs far better than a vent drilled through a finished frame on site.
